From 8602f4aa742ed3a05d8cb3c52bf978ea7572229e Mon Sep 17 00:00:00 2001 From: "Benjamin E. Coe" Date: Sun, 19 May 2019 22:53:37 -0700 Subject: [PATCH] feat!: default temp directory to report directory (#102) BREAKING CHANGE: temp directory now defaults to setting for report directory --- lib/parse-args.js |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/lib/parse-args.js b/lib/parse-args.js index bc920c45..389955f2 100644 --- a/lib/parse-args.js +++ b/lib/parse-args.js @@ -61,7 +61,6 @@ function buildYargs (withCommands = false) { type: 'boolean' }) .option('temp-directory', { - default: './coverage/tmp', describe: 'directory V8 coverage data is written to and read from' }) .option('resolve', { @@ -85,6 +84,12 @@ function buildYargs (withCommands = false) { .pkgConf('c8') .config(config) .demandCommand(1) + .check((argv) => { + if (!argv.tempDirectory) { + argv.tempDirectory = argv.reportsDir + } + return true + }) .epilog('visit https://git.io/vHysA for list of available reporters') const checkCoverage = require('./commands/check-coverage')